Effective Critical Thinking: Core Principles for Better Decisions

We make hundreds of decisions every day, but not all of them receive the same level of thought. Some choices are simple, like deciding what to eat for lunch.

Others involve money, careers, relationships, business strategies, health information, or claims we see online. In those situations, relying only on instinct or first impressions can easily lead us in the wrong direction.

That is where effective critical thinking becomes useful. Critical thinking is not about being negative, argumentative, or constantly doubting everything.

Instead, it is about slowing down enough to understand a problem, examine available information, question assumptions, and reach a conclusion that is supported by good reasons.

The Stanford Encyclopedia of Philosophy describes critical thinking broadly as careful, goal-directed thinking. In practice, that means thinking with purpose rather than simply reacting.

Understanding the core principles of effective critical thinking can help anyone make smarter decisions, communicate better, solve problems more efficiently, and avoid being easily influenced by weak arguments or misleading information.

1. Start With a Clear Purpose and Question

Good critical thinking usually begins with one basic question: What am I actually trying to figure out?

It sounds obvious, but people often start researching, debating, or making decisions before clearly defining the problem. When the question is vague, the thinking that follows can become equally unclear.

For example, imagine a company asking, “Why are our sales bad?” That question is too broad. A stronger version might be, “Why did online sales fall by 15% during the last quarter compared with the same period last year?”

The second question creates a clearer target. It tells you what period, channel, and outcome you need to investigate.

Clarifying purpose also prevents information overload. Monash University recommends identifying the purpose and context of a thinking task so that people can focus on evidence that is actually useful.

Before looking for answers, define the problem carefully. A clear question gives your reasoning direction.

2. Separate Claims, Reasons, and Evidence

One of the most useful principles of effective critical thinking is learning how arguments are built.

Most arguments contain three important elements: a claim, reasons supporting that claim, and evidence supporting those reasons.

Suppose someone says, “Remote work increases productivity because employees experience fewer workplace interruptions.”

The claim is that remote work increases productivity. The reason is fewer interruptions.

To decide whether the argument is convincing, you still need evidence showing whether remote workers actually experience fewer interruptions and whether that difference improves measurable productivity.

A statement can sound confident without being well supported.

Monash University explains that identifying claims, reasons, and evidence helps people analyse how arguments work instead of simply accepting the conclusion.

This habit is especially useful when reading news stories, advertisements, research summaries, political arguments, social media posts, or workplace proposals.

3. Evaluate the Quality of Evidence

Finding evidence is not enough. The evidence also needs to be credible, accurate, recent enough for the topic, and relevent to the question.

Imagine two people arguing about whether a particular training programme improves employee performance. One person provides a survey of 12 employees from a single office. The other provides data from several thousand employees across multiple organisations.

Neither study should automatically be accepted, but the second one may provide stronger evidence depending on how the research was conducted.

Critical thinkers ask questions such as: Who produced the information? What methods were used? How large was the sample? Is the source independent? Are important details missing? Can the findings be replicated?

Monash University notes that strong evaluation involves examining not only evidence but also methodology, limitations, reliability, and possible alternative interpretations.

The goal is not to demand perfect evidence. Perfect information rarely exists. The goal is to understand how much confidence the available evidence deserves.

4. Check Whether the Reasoning Actually Makes Sense

Even accurate information can lead to a weak conclusion if the reasoning connecting the evidence and claim is flawed.

Consider this argument:

“A successful entrepreneur wakes up at 5 a.m. Therefore, waking up at 5 a.m. makes people successful.”

The observation may be true, but the conclusion does not necessarily follow. Success can depend on experience, resources, skills, timing, connections, industry conditions, and countless other factors.

This is why logic matters.

Strong critical thinking asks whether the evidence genuinely supports the conclusion, rather than whether the conclusion simply sounds believable.

According to the Foundation for Critical Thinking, high-quality reasoning involves standards such as clarity, accuracy, precision, relevance, consistency, depth, breadth, and fairness.

Whenever you reach a conclusion, try asking, “How exactly did I get from this evidence to this conclusion?”

That simple question can expose surprisingly large gaps in reasoning.

5. Question Assumptions and Watch for Bias

Every person has assumptions. The problem is not having them; the problem is treating them as facts without noticing.

Imagine a manager who believes younger employees are naturally better with technology. When hiring someone for a digital role, the manager might unconsciously favour younger candidates even when older applicants have stronger technical experience.

That assumption influences the decision before the evidence is fully examined.

Bias can work in similar ways.

Confirmation bias, for example, encourages people to notice information that supports what they already believe while ignoring conflicting evidence.

Someone convinced that a certain diet is extremely effective may remember every positive testimonial but dismiss studies showing weaker results.

Effective critical thinking requires intellectual self-awareness. You have to ask whether you are evaluating the evidence fairly or simply searching for reasons to protect an existing opinion.

This can feel uncomfortable becuase changing your mind may require admitting that an earlier conclusion was incomplete or incorrect. Yet being willing to revise your position is a major strength of good reasoning.

6. Consider Alternative Perspectives

Critical thinking becomes stronger when you deliberately examine viewpoints that compete with your own.

This does not mean every opinion deserves equal weight. Evidence still matters. However, different perspectives may reveal assumptions, risks, or possibilities you initially missed.

Suppose a business wants to introduce fully automated customer service.

From a cost perspective, automation may look attractive. From a customer perspective, complicated problems might still require human support.

From an employee perspective, automation could change job responsibilities. From a compliance perspective, sensitive customer data might create additional risks.

Looking at these perspectives seperate from one another produces a more complete picture of the decision.

The Foundation for Critical Thinking describes strong thinkers as people who consider alternative systems of thought while examining assumptions, implications, and practical consequences.

The point is not to become indecisive. It is to make decisions after understanding more than one side of the issue.

7. Distinguish What You Know From What You Assume

Critical thinkers are comfortable saying, “I don’t know yet.”

That phrase can actually be a sign of intellectual strength.

When information is incomplete, people often fill gaps with assumptions. Eventually, those assumptions can start feeling like facts.

A useful approach is to mentally divide information into three categories: what you know, what you reasonably infer, and what remains uncertain.

For example, if website traffic drops after a redesign, you know the redesign and traffic decline occurred around the same time. You might infer that the redesign contributed to the decline. But you do not yet know that it caused the problem.

Other factors may have changed simultaneously, such as advertising spending, search rankings, seasonal demand, or technical performance.

Keeping facts and assumptions consistantly separated prevents premature conclusions.

It also helps you recognise when more research is needed before making an important decision.

8. Build Conclusions That Can Change With New Evidence

The final principle is simple but powerful: a conclusion should not become permanent just because you reached it once.

Strong critical thinkers treat many conclusions as provisional.

If new high-quality evidence appears, the conclusion may need updating. This is especially important in areas such as science, technology, business, economics, and public policy, where information changes regularly.

Critical thinking is therefore self-correcting. The Foundation for Critical Thinking describes it as a process that involves monitoring and improving one’s own thinking rather than blindly defending previous beliefs.

A practical habit is to ask, “What evidence would make me change my mind?”

If the honest answer is “nothing,” you may no longer be evaluating the issue critically.

Good reasoning is not about winning an argument. It is about getting closer to the best available explanation or decision.

Understanding the core principles of effective critical thinking can dramatically improve the way we evaluate information, solve problems, and make everyday decisions.

It begins with asking clear questions, identifying claims and evidence, examining reasoning, recognising assumptions, and considering alternative viewpoints.

Just as importantly, critical thinkers understand that uncertainty is normal. They are willing to adjust their conclusions when stronger evidence becomes available instead of becoming emotionally attached to an earlier opinion.

Critical thinking is not a talent reserved for academics or experts. It is a skill that becomes stronger through regular practice.
